Peugeot Speedfight 2 50 - 2009 Specifications and Reviews

The 2009 Peugeot Speedfight 2 50 is an entry-level automatic scooter ideal for new riders and urban commuters seeking economical, nimble city transport. Its lightweight 90kg frame and compact dimensions deliver excellent maneuverability in congested traffic, while the reliable single-cylinder engine offers dependable everyday performance. Best known for accessible styling and practical commuting credentials.

Engine and Transmission Specifications

Transmission typefinal driveBelt
GearboxAutomatic
StarterElectric & kick
Fuel systemCarburettor
Stroke2
Engine typeSingle cylinder
Capacity:49.10 ccm (3.00 cubic inches)
 
 

Physical measures and capacities

Overall width810 mm (31.9 inches)
Overall length1,730 mm (68.1 inches)
Dry weight90.0 kg (198.4 pounds)

Peugeot Speedfight 2 50 dimensions and frame

Rear brakesExpanding brake (drum brake). Optional disk
Front brakesSingle disc
Rear tyre dimensions130/70-12
Front tyre dimensions120/70-12

Speed and acceleration

Color optionsOrange, silver, blue, black, red
Fuel capacity7.20 litres (1.90 gallons)

Rider Profile

Best ForSuitable for beginner riders or those holding a moped/scooter license, requiring minimal prior riding skill.
PurposeDesigned primarily for short urban hops, commuting, and running errands around town.
Rider FitLightweight and low-slung, making it easy for riders of almost any size or strength to handle at low speeds and while parked.
CharacterA sporty-styled 50cc city scooter that prioritizes nimble handling and youthful looks over outright performance.
Not Ideal ForNot suitable for highway travel, long-distance touring, or riders seeking real speed and power.
